abbas3zaar
یک شنبه 20 فروردین 1396, 22:32 عصر
سلام.
این خروجی یک کوئری منه
http://uupload.ir/files/2h24_123123123123.jpg
حالا میخوام سطر هام رنگ داشته باشه به این صورت که سطرهایی که "تاریخ روزشون یکی هست" رنگ پس زمینه سطرشون یه رنگ باشه
برای مثال در عکس بالا 2 تا سفارش مربوط تاریخ 20 فروردین 96 داریم که میخوام هر دو سطر یک رنگ باشن
مثلا 10 تا سطر داشته باشیم که برای تاریخ مثلا 15 ام فروردین 96 باشه 10 تا سطر یک رنگ باشن
توی کوئری چجوری باید این کارو بکنم؟
http://uupload.ir/files/9u1k_2423234234.jpg
اینم کدهای مربوط به نمایش این عکس بالا:
<table class="table table-bordered table-hover table-striped table-condensed">
<thead>
<tr>
<th style="text-align:center">ردیف</th>
<th style="text-align:center">مشتری</th>
<th style="text-align:center">مبلغ سفارش</th>
<th style="text-align:center">تاریخ</th>
<th style="text-align:center">ساعت</th>
<th style="text-align:center">وضعیت</th>
<th style="text-align:center">عملیات</th>
<th style="text-align:center">مشاهده</th>
</tr>
</thead>
<tbody>
<?php
while ($row = mysql_fetch_array($do)){
$res[$i]["order_id"] = $row["order_id"];
$res[$i]["order_customer_id"] = $row["order_customer_id"];
$res[$i]["order_total_price"] = $row["order_total_price"];
$res[$i]["order_status"] = $row["order_status"];
$res[$i]["order_created"] = $row["order_created"];
$res[$i]["customer_name"] = $row["customer_name"];
$mydate = $res[$i]['order_created'];
$strTime = strtotime($mydate);
echo '<tr>';
echo '<td style="text-align:center">';
echo fa_digits($numrow);
echo '</td>';
echo '<td style="text-align:center">';
echo $res[$i]["customer_name"];
echo '</td>';
echo '<td style="text-align:center">';
echo '<span style="font-size:17px;">';
echo fa_digits(number_format($res[$i]['order_total_price']));
echo '</span>';
echo '<span class="text-muted" style="font-size:11px;"> تومان</span>';
echo '</td>';
echo '<td style="text-align:center">';
echo jdate('l (Y/m/d)', $strTime);
echo '</td>';
echo '<td style="text-align:center">';
echo jdate('H:i', $strTime);
echo '<span class="text-muted" style="font-size:11px;"> دقیقه</span>';
echo '</td>';
echo '<td style="text-align:center">';
if($res[$i]['order_status'] == 1){
echo "<a href='ViewOrders.php?disable={$res[$i]["order_id"]}'>فعال</a>";
} else {
echo "<a href='ViewOrders.php?enable={$res[$i]["order_id"]}'>غیرفعال</a>";
}
echo "</td>";
echo '<td style="text-align:center" class="actions"><div class="btn-group">';
echo '<a class="btn btn-inverse btn-xs" href="ViewOrders.php?edit='.$res[$i]["order_id"].'"><i class="fa fa-pencil"></i> ویرایش</a>';
echo '<a class="btn btn-danger btn-xs" href="ViewOrders.php?delete='.$res[$i]["order_id"].'"><i class="fa fa-trash-o"></i> حذف</a>';
echo '</div></td>';
echo '<td style="text-align:center"><a href="ViewOrderDetails.php" class="btn btn-primary btn-xs btn-custom">جزئیات سفارش</a></td>';
echo '</tr>';
$numrow++;
$i++;
}
}else
{
echo '<tr>
<td colspan="8" align=center>
<div>سفارشی فعلا ثبت نشده است</div>
</td>
</tr>';
}
?>
</tbody>
</table>
این خروجی یک کوئری منه
http://uupload.ir/files/2h24_123123123123.jpg
حالا میخوام سطر هام رنگ داشته باشه به این صورت که سطرهایی که "تاریخ روزشون یکی هست" رنگ پس زمینه سطرشون یه رنگ باشه
برای مثال در عکس بالا 2 تا سفارش مربوط تاریخ 20 فروردین 96 داریم که میخوام هر دو سطر یک رنگ باشن
مثلا 10 تا سطر داشته باشیم که برای تاریخ مثلا 15 ام فروردین 96 باشه 10 تا سطر یک رنگ باشن
توی کوئری چجوری باید این کارو بکنم؟
http://uupload.ir/files/9u1k_2423234234.jpg
اینم کدهای مربوط به نمایش این عکس بالا:
<table class="table table-bordered table-hover table-striped table-condensed">
<thead>
<tr>
<th style="text-align:center">ردیف</th>
<th style="text-align:center">مشتری</th>
<th style="text-align:center">مبلغ سفارش</th>
<th style="text-align:center">تاریخ</th>
<th style="text-align:center">ساعت</th>
<th style="text-align:center">وضعیت</th>
<th style="text-align:center">عملیات</th>
<th style="text-align:center">مشاهده</th>
</tr>
</thead>
<tbody>
<?php
while ($row = mysql_fetch_array($do)){
$res[$i]["order_id"] = $row["order_id"];
$res[$i]["order_customer_id"] = $row["order_customer_id"];
$res[$i]["order_total_price"] = $row["order_total_price"];
$res[$i]["order_status"] = $row["order_status"];
$res[$i]["order_created"] = $row["order_created"];
$res[$i]["customer_name"] = $row["customer_name"];
$mydate = $res[$i]['order_created'];
$strTime = strtotime($mydate);
echo '<tr>';
echo '<td style="text-align:center">';
echo fa_digits($numrow);
echo '</td>';
echo '<td style="text-align:center">';
echo $res[$i]["customer_name"];
echo '</td>';
echo '<td style="text-align:center">';
echo '<span style="font-size:17px;">';
echo fa_digits(number_format($res[$i]['order_total_price']));
echo '</span>';
echo '<span class="text-muted" style="font-size:11px;"> تومان</span>';
echo '</td>';
echo '<td style="text-align:center">';
echo jdate('l (Y/m/d)', $strTime);
echo '</td>';
echo '<td style="text-align:center">';
echo jdate('H:i', $strTime);
echo '<span class="text-muted" style="font-size:11px;"> دقیقه</span>';
echo '</td>';
echo '<td style="text-align:center">';
if($res[$i]['order_status'] == 1){
echo "<a href='ViewOrders.php?disable={$res[$i]["order_id"]}'>فعال</a>";
} else {
echo "<a href='ViewOrders.php?enable={$res[$i]["order_id"]}'>غیرفعال</a>";
}
echo "</td>";
echo '<td style="text-align:center" class="actions"><div class="btn-group">';
echo '<a class="btn btn-inverse btn-xs" href="ViewOrders.php?edit='.$res[$i]["order_id"].'"><i class="fa fa-pencil"></i> ویرایش</a>';
echo '<a class="btn btn-danger btn-xs" href="ViewOrders.php?delete='.$res[$i]["order_id"].'"><i class="fa fa-trash-o"></i> حذف</a>';
echo '</div></td>';
echo '<td style="text-align:center"><a href="ViewOrderDetails.php" class="btn btn-primary btn-xs btn-custom">جزئیات سفارش</a></td>';
echo '</tr>';
$numrow++;
$i++;
}
}else
{
echo '<tr>
<td colspan="8" align=center>
<div>سفارشی فعلا ثبت نشده است</div>
</td>
</tr>';
}
?>
</tbody>
</table>